  • Key Developer Quits Novell over Microsoft Patent Pact

    Jeremy Allison, a leading Samba developer and well-known open-source speaker, has decided to leave Novell because of his objections to the Microsoft/Novell patent agreement.     During the past several years, investment company Thoma Cressey Equity Partners has made its presence felt in the software world, and 2006 was no exception. In just the last few months, the company acquired and merged Vision Solutions International and iTera. Then, Thoma Cressey entered into a recapitalization agreement with Sirius Computer Solutions.
